The U.S. Army Intelligence and Security Command (INSCOM) conducts multi-disciplined (SIGINT, CI, HUMINT, GEOINT, MASINT, BIOMETRICS) and all-source intelligence operations to include collection, analysis, production, and dissemination; network warfare operations, information operations; knowledge management for the Army intelligence enterprise; and delivers specialized quick reaction capabilities, advanced skills training, and linguist support for deploying forces to enable battle command in support of full-spectrum Army, joint, coalition and interagency worldwide operations. The INSCOM G-4 proposes to acquire comprehensive engineering and logistics support for intelligence community (IC) ground and airborne intelligence, surveillance, and reconnaissance (ISR) systems and ancillary ground support equipment at worldwide locations. Genesis IV will ensure that electronic systems, security systems, Quick Reaction Capability (QRC) systems, and prototype systems are deployed quickly, repaired quickly, and maintained at the highest state of readiness. Genesis IV will include network administration, hardware and software support, transportation/shipping support, and training for system operator and maintainers. Genesis IV will also provide facility engineering and maintenance support at the sites that house ISR systems. That support will include the development of designs and project documentation for Operations and Maintenance (O&M) level projects to address routine and unique power requirements, cooling requirements, mission growth, unit transformations and realignments of ISR assets to other locations when required as well as facility enhancements and renovations. The Genesis IV requirement is a five year requirement. The period of performance is targeted to be September 2012 through September 2017. All work will be performed at a Top Secret/SCI clearance level.
